Key Insights
- →Claycomo has a safety grade of D with a violent crime rate of 442.2 per 100,000 residents (national avg: 359.1).
- →Violent crime dropped 24.7% from the previous year.
- →Crime trajectory: volatile — based on 3 years of data.
- →Safer than 15% of all cities in the OpenCrime database.
- →Violent-to-property crime ratio: 0.11 (below national average).

Year-over-Year Comparison
| Year | Population | Violent Crime | Violent Rate | Murders | Property Crime | Property Rate |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2024 | 1,357 | 6 | 442.2 | 0 | 53 | 3905.7 |
| 2023 | 1,362 | 8 | 587.4 | 0 | 61 | 4478.7 |
| 2022 | 1,374 | 2 | 145.6 | 0 | 62 | 4512.4 |
